On Friday evening the Hamilton County Sheriff’s Office was notified that a fugitive who had evaded law enforcement for approximately ten months, Jeremichael Nicholson, was at Erlanger Hospital visiting another patient.
Nicholson was previously arrested, and a bonding company paid more than $100,000 for his release. While out on bond, Nicholson received additional charges.
Deputies confirmed Nicholson had multiple active warrants through both the Hamilton County Criminal Court and the Hamilton County Sessions Court for the following charges of Aggravated Assault, Evading Arrest, Aggravated Domestic Assault, Violation of an Order of Protection, and Assault.
Deputies located and arrested Nicholson without disruption to Erlanger operations. He was transported to the Hamilton County Jail and Detention Center.
